7. Thesis TitlePublic opinion on the issue of chemical contamination in Bien Hoa City (Case study in Trung Dung Ward and Tan Phong Ward)

10. Summary of the thesis results:
(Summarize the results of the thesis, emphasizing any new findings.)
Bien Hoa Airport is the area with the heaviest dioxin contamination among dioxin hotspots in Vietnam. Dioxin will continue to pollute the environment and endanger the health of the local population.
People are aware that their living areas are contaminated with dioxin, but the level of understanding is inconsistent. Through an assessment of knowledge regarding the presence of dioxin in the environment and the pathways by which it enters the human body, we found that the number of people with a deep understanding of the effects of dioxin is very limited. This has directly impacted people's behavior and health protection practices.
There is no discrimination in daily life against victims and their families of Agent Orange, however, there is underlying stigma in the community when it comes to decisions related to marriage and family due to the hereditary effects of dioxin.
Public opinion regarding the lives of Agent Orange victims reveals that the victims and their families constantly face numerous difficulties. They struggle with life while also bearing heavy psychological burdens about their lineage and the future of their children.
Through communication activities, the awareness of Bien Hoa city residents regarding the issue of dioxin has been significantly raised. However, for public opinion to effectively play its control and educational functions in preventing dioxin exposure, communication activities providing detailed information about exposure routes, prevention methods, and consequences of dioxin are needed to minimize and prevent new exposures in the community.
